The National Disaster Management Authority (NDMA) spokesperson has issued an alert for further rain accompanied by thunder across the country.
According to details surfaced on Saturday, rain is expected in most parts of the country during the next 12 to 24 hours, the NDMA said. Snowfall is also likely in the upper mountainous areas of Gilgit-Baltistan and Azad Kashmir.
Rain with the possibility of hailstorms has been forecast for upper Khyber Pakhtunkhwa as well as the plains. In Islamabad and various cities of Punjab, rain is also expected, according to the NDMA.
Several areas of Balochistan may receive rain with thunder. Authorities have warned that wet conditions may make roads slippery and disrupt the flow of traffic.
In hilly areas, traffic may be affected. Travellers have been advised to exercise caution.
